Why does concrete sink and crack in Bristol?

Concrete starts out strong, rigid, and weighty, making it a great material for residential patios and driveways to warehouse floors. Over time, the level soil underneath the concrete begins to shift with changes in the moisture content in the ground. Soil movement causes voids under the concrete and because concrete is heavy, it starts to sink. Because it’s rigid and inflexible, it starts to crack. Soil movement occurs in a variety of ways, including:

  • Backfilled Soil: Loose soil that is backfilled when a home is built is often not well compacted and settles over time, resulting in one or more voids under the concrete.
  • Droughts & Soil Shrinkage: In droughts, the soils under your concrete shrink, causing voids, as well as cracks and crevices in the concrete.
  • Rainfall & Erosion: When it rains, water finds its way into and under concrete slabs, causing the soil to soften and weaken, or wash away, leaving voids.

Soil movement is bound to occur, but the damage sunken concrete leaves behind doesn’t have to be permanent. Trusted concrete leveling solutions can easily help resolve such issues.

Mudjacking, also called slab jacking, is a well-known technique for lifting uneven concrete to a level position. Compared to using foam to lift and level concrete, mudjacking has several drawbacks that Bristol homeowners should know. One major disadvantage is that mudjacking doesn’t address the underlying causes of sunken concrete. It's also messy and disruptive and often damaging to property and landscaping.
